WebAn Ignition Interlock is a device installed into a vehicle that prevents the vehicle from starting or operating until the driver first provides a breath sample. If the breath sample measures a breath alcohol content of 0.025% (0.020% for those under 21) or greater, the vehicle will not be able to start. WebIf the device detects alcohol, the vehicle will not start. The device is also designed to collect random breath samples while the vehicle is being driven. WebIn Giomi v. DMV, 1971 15 Cal.AppJd 905 the officer told the driver a refusal “could’ result in a suspension. The court considered the driver’s reply to the officer, “they won’t take my driver’s license” as an indication that the driver was in fact misled as to the consequences of refusal to take a chemical test.
